Recently I got myself cable internet (gasps), and from that time on I've been experiencing abnormal system reboots (just happens by itself).
However, I have noticed that this only occurs whilst my modem is SENDING data - for example - I send a large email, or transfer a large file. What also happens sometimes is the wonderful windows blue screen appears (MSTCP error)... which closes the responsible appliation (namely the app which is doing the sending)
I have tried looking around for a solution, however I have been unsuccessful! I would really appreciate if someone could help me, because frankly, it's get VERY annoying!!
Thanks,
Mr Bernie (bernie@zhytek.com)(ICQ#11203153)
Sounds like you got an IRQ conflict. Try changing the IRQ of your NIC (or change the slot that it is in). You can change the IRQ thru windows or the mobo's BIOS.
